Leonard Spigelgass

 
Writer: Leonard Spigelgass
  • Occupation: Writer
  • Active: '30s-'50s
  • Major Genres: Comedy, Romance
  • Career Highlights: Silk Stockings, Gypsy, I Was a Male War Bride
  • First Major Screen Credit: Hello Sister! (1933)

Biography

American producer and screenwriter Leonard Spigelgass got his start collaborating on the script of Von Stroheim's Hello Sister (1933). In 1950, Spigelgass received an Oscar nomination for the story of Mystery Street. He was also a playwright and penned such dramas as Dear Me the Sky Is Falling and A Remedy for Winter. He has also written plays for such television series as Playhouse 90. In addition to his screen work, Spigelgass has written novels such as Million Dollar Baby and Fed to the Teeth. ~ Sandra Brennan, All Movie Guide
